The 74ALVTHR16245ZQLR is a cutting-edge, high-speed, 16-bit transceiver from the renowned semiconductor manufacturer, Texas Instruments. This device is designed to address the needs of high-performance data transfer systems, by providing bidirectional interface communication between two buses. The transceiver is part of the ALVTHR family, which is known for its low-voltage, high-speed operation with true rail-to-rail performance.
Key Features
- Technology: The device is built on an advanced BiCMOS technology, allowing for minimal power consumption while maintaining high-speed operation.
- Voltage Range: It operates at a 2.5V to 3.3V voltage range, making it compatible with low-voltage systems and reducing power requirements.
- Speed: The 74ALVTHR16245ZQLR offers high-speed data transfer capabilities, with a maximum data rate that meets the requirements of the most demanding applications.
- Bus-Hold: Integrated bus-hold circuitry on the data inputs eliminates the need for external pull-up or pull-down resistors, simplifying board design and reducing component count.
- Drive Capability: This transceiver can drive heavily loaded outputs with a 24 mA output drive capability at 3.3V, ensuring reliable communication in various environments.
- Package: The device comes in a compact, surface-mount package, making it suitable for space-constrained applications.
